Festo Pneumatic Actuated Valve, 1-1/4 in Thread size, Ball Valve Type - VZBM-A-11/4-RP-25-F-3L-B2-PB80, Numeric Part Number: 8070271


This pneumatic actuated valve is a 3-way ball valve designed for efficient flow control in industrial applications. Constructed from nickel-plated brass, it features a nominal width of 1-1/4 in with an Rp thread for pneumatic actuation. The valve operates under a maximum pressure of 25 bar, suitable for a range of gaseous and fluid media.

What is the operating temperature range for this valve?


The valve can operate effectively in temperatures between -20°C and 130°C, ensuring it can handle a wide variety of environments.

Can it be used with lubricated operation?


Yes, lubricated operation is possible but may be required for further use, making it adaptable for different operation preferences.

What materials are used in the construction of the valve?


The housing is made from nickel-plated brass, and the seals are composed of HNBR and PTFE, providing durability and ensuring compatibility with various media.

What type of fluids can this valve handle?


It is designed for use with compressed air, inert gases, water (without water vapour), and neutral fluids, offering versatility in applications.
